Clinchers appear as the last sentence of well-written social media posts, blogposts, essays, or book chapters. Sometimes, you also find them at the end of a section within a chapter or blogpost—just before a subhead announces the next section. Compose a clincher to summarize your key point with a punch.

Tie that same concept into contentmarketing, and you’ve got gamified content. In other words, content that incorporates common features found in games, like puzzles, points, leaderboards, and badges. What is gamification in marketing? Don’t think of it as turning your entire blog or app into a video game.
